Energy Dysfunction: Causes, Symptoms, and Solutions

Mitochondrial malfunction represents a complex issue where the powerhouses of our cells – the mitochondria – aren't working properly. Several factors can cause this, including genetic mutations, exposure to harmful substances like pesticides or heavy metals, ongoing inflammation, and even the progressive process of aging supplements for mitochondrial repair itself. Symptoms are incredibly diverse and can manifest as tiredness, muscle aches, neurological challenges (like memory difficulties), digestive disturbances, and heart complications. Fortunately, while often treatable, there's growing focus on available solutions. These approaches often involve dietary changes emphasizing nutrient-dense foods, supplementation with compounds like CoQ10 or acetyl-L-carnitine, targeted exercise, and addressing any underlying health issues. Further research continues to reveal new and effective avenues for improving mitochondrial health.

Enhancing Cellular Energy: Essential Mitochondrial Supplements

The incredible engines powering virtually every cell in your body, mitochondria, require targeted support to function at their peak. These microscopic powerhouses are responsible for generating ATP, the fuel that keeps you going, and declining mitochondrial function can contribute to fatigue, accelerated aging, and a host of other health concerns. Fortunately, several compounds can provide valuable assistance in bolstering mitochondrial health. Consider incorporating coenzyme Q10, crucial for the electron transport chain and a potent antioxidant, into your routine. Furthermore, thioctic acid, a potent antioxidant, can regenerate other antioxidants and boost mitochondrial function. Certain B vitamins, particularly B12 and folate, play vital roles in mitochondrial activity. Lastly, pQQ, a interesting nutrient, has demonstrated the ability to stimulate the creation of new mitochondria, offering a promising approach to renewal. Before commencing any new supplement protocol, it’s always wise to consult with a doctor to ensure it aligns with your individual requirements and goals.
